Transaction bf24dd81330229c1548c7d82642fd5c9b8bb975f55253b4ed3dc70633ab7a8ce
1 Input
1 Output
-
bf24dd81330229c1548c7d82642fd5c9b8bb975f55253b4ed3dc70633ab7a8ce:0
- value
- 451725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a5360c968f619c13612d095c82e017ca270d826 OP_EQUAL
- address
- 32dcZfwNLsBBJ4eJUfNh5UYqRpzuHGHkSa